Arriving at Cesky Krumlov

Yesterday we left a cold Vienna as snow fell and drove through fog and snow covered fields into the Czech Republic. As we neared our Christmas stopover town we left the snow and reached an area having unusually mild conditions for this time of the year (8 deg) so unfortunately no snow for Christmas. The town is in a valley inside a tight loop in the Moldau River and is just beautiful with the old castle perched on the hill above the town. Last night we joined the town folk watching a "live Bethlehem" performance of the Nativity story told through local folk songs and carols. It was a delightful experience.
